The GCC Explosion: From Back-Office to $100B Powerhouse
GCCs in India 2026 represent a seismic shift. Over 1,800 centers employ 2M+ professionals, with the sector hitting $46B now and eyeing $105-110B by 2030. Bengaluru, Hyderabad, Pune, Chennai, Mumbai, and NCR dominate, fueled by talent, infra, and policies.
In my consulting days, I watched GCCs evolve from BPM drudgery to AI engineering hubs. Now, they’re not just executing—they’re designing enterprise-wide AI systems for automotive, BFSI, healthcare, and more. The kicker? India holds 53% of global GCCs, making it the undisputed hub.
Why AI-Native Engineering Is GCCs’ Global Weapon
AI-native means GCCs aren’t bolting AI on; it’s the foundation. 75% plan GenAI embedding by 2026, with AI co-pilots and hybrid tech-non-tech roles exploding 1.3x. Global firms use Indian GCCs to design, test, and scale AI-driven ops—from finance automation to software dev.
Here’s the game-changer from client workshops: Indian teams now own full product cycles—architecture, testing, release, feedback. This “engineering brain” shift gives MNCs dominance in AI-competitive markets. Hyderabad (70%) and Bengaluru (69%) lead AI leadership maturity.

Talent Wars: Hiring Shifts for AI Dominance
GCCs are ditching mass hiring for precision strikes on AI, cloud, cyber skills. Expect 200K net adds in 2026, but with 14-18% attrition demanding 300K replacements yearly. Roles? AI leaders, product heads, risk/compliance experts.
Tier-2 cities like Coimbatore and Jaipur are hot for STEM talent, thanks to state incentives and infra. Salaries? 25-30% above market, pulling global pros. In my network, GCCs with strong AI governance (33% have central CoEs) retain best.
- Must-hire skills: GenAI engineering, cyber modernization, cloud platforms.
- Leadership bet: AI visionaries who blend tech with business impact.
Hubs Leading the AI Charge
Bengaluru and Hyderabad top AI maturity; Delhi/NCR excels in governance (39% centralized). Pune and Chennai follow for engineering depth; NCR for BFSI AI.
Progressive states offer AI incentives, turning regions into innovation corridors. Pro tip from my GCC audits: Hubs with decentralized oversight (Hyderabad 35%) move faster on pilots.

Challenges: Attrition, Ethics, and the Skills Gap
200K hires sound great, but 300K replacements? Attrition bites. Ethical AI lags in rapid scaling; governance institutionalizes slowly. Skills gap? Non-metro STEM ramps up, but leadership readiness varies.
Fixes: Skills-based hiring, AI ethics training, retention via equity/impact roles. I’ve seen 15% attrition drops with transparent AI roadmaps.

How many jobs will GCCs in India create in 2026?
GCCs in India 2026 will add 200K net headcount on a 2M base, plus 300K replacements from 14-18% attrition—totaling massive opportunity. Growth hits 12-15% in IT hiring, focused on AI engineering, cloud, cyber. Around 120 new mid-sized GCCs spawn 40K jobs; tier-2 cities boom via incentives. Salaries 25-30% premium pull talent, but selective hiring favors specialists over volume.
